  • The Rise Of Additive Technology In Manufacturing

    In recent years, there has been a significant shift in the way that products are being manufactured. Traditional manufacturing methods, such as subtractive manufacturing, have been increasingly replaced by a new and innovative process known as additive technology. Also known as 3D printing, additive technology is revolutionizing the way that goods are produced across a wide range of industries.

    additive technology involves building up a product layer by layer, as opposed to traditional manufacturing methods that involve cutting away material to create the final product. This additive process allows for greater design flexibility, faster production times, and reduced waste. As a result, additive technology has become increasingly popular in industries such as aerospace, automotive, healthcare, and consumer goods.

    One of the key advantages of additive technology is its ability to create complex geometric shapes that would be impossible to produce using traditional manufacturing methods. This has opened up new design possibilities for engineers and designers, leading to more innovative and functional products. additive technology also allows for the production of customized and personalized goods, making it an attractive option for industries such as healthcare and consumer goods.

    Another benefit of additive technology is its ability to reduce production times. Traditional manufacturing methods often require expensive tooling and long lead times to produce a new product. With additive technology, products can be created quickly and easily, allowing for rapid prototyping and shorter time-to-market. This has enabled companies to be more agile and responsive to changing market demands, giving them a competitive edge in today’s fast-paced business environment.

    In addition to flexibility and speed, additive technology also offers significant cost savings. By using additive technology, companies can reduce material waste and energy consumption, leading to lower production costs. In some cases, additive technology can also eliminate the need for expensive tooling and fixtures, further lowering the overall production costs. This cost-effectiveness has made additive technology an attractive option for companies looking to improve their bottom line and increase their competitiveness.

    additive technology is also playing a crucial role in the healthcare industry, where it is being used to create customized medical implants, prosthetics, and surgical instruments. By using additive technology, healthcare providers can create personalized solutions for patients, improving treatment outcomes and quality of life. Additive technology has also enabled the production of complex medical devices that were previously not possible using traditional manufacturing methods, leading to advancements in patient care and medical technology.

    The aerospace and automotive industries have also embraced additive technology, using it to create lightweight and durable components for aircraft and vehicles. Additive technology allows engineers to design parts with intricate internal structures that would be impossible to produce using traditional methods. This has led to significant weight savings in aircraft and vehicles, increasing fuel efficiency and performance. Additive technology has also enabled the rapid prototyping of new designs, allowing companies to quickly iterate and improve their products.

    As additive technology continues to evolve, researchers and engineers are exploring new materials and processes to further expand its capabilities. Additive technology is no longer limited to plastics and polymers, with advancements in metal 3D printing enabling the production of high-strength and heat-resistant components. Researchers are also experimenting with new additives such as ceramics, composites, and bio-materials, opening up new possibilities for applications in various industries.

  • Safeguarding Your Documents: The Importance Of Archival Boxes For Documents

    In today’s fast-paced digital world, it’s easy to forget the importance of physical documents and records. Whether it’s a birth certificate, a family heirloom, or important business documents, these pieces of paper hold great value and significance. That’s why it’s crucial to properly store and protect these documents from damage, loss, or deterioration. And one of the best ways to do so is by using archival boxes for documents.

    Archival boxes are specially designed containers that offer long-term protection for important documents. They are typically made from acid-free and lignin-free materials, which help prevent yellowing, fading, or deteriorating of the contents over time. Additionally, archival boxes are often buffered with calcium carbonate to help neutralize acids that may be present in the documents, further ensuring their preservation.

    One of the key benefits of using archival boxes for documents is their ability to protect against environmental factors that can damage paper-based materials. Light, humidity, temperature fluctuations, and pollutants can all contribute to the deterioration of documents over time. By storing important papers in archival boxes, you can help shield them from these harmful elements and extend their lifespan.

    Another advantage of archival boxes is their durability and strength. These boxes are designed to provide sturdy support and protection for documents, helping to prevent bending, tearing, or creasing. Moreover, some archival boxes are reinforced with metal edges or corners for added strength, making them ideal for storing delicate or valuable papers.

    Organizing and storing documents in archival boxes also helps to prevent loss or misplacement. By keeping all your important papers in one secure and designated location, you can easily locate them whenever needed. This can be particularly beneficial for businesses, legal firms, government agencies, and individuals who deal with a large volume of documents and need to access them quickly and efficiently.

    Archival boxes come in a variety of sizes, shapes, and designs to accommodate different types of documents. Whether you need to store standard letter-sized papers, legal documents, photographs, maps, or oversized materials, there is an archival box that meets your specific needs. Some boxes even feature compartments, dividers, or labels for better organization and identification of contents.

    When it comes to selecting archival boxes for documents, it’s important to choose high-quality, archival-grade materials that meet industry standards for preservation. Look for boxes that are acid-free, lignin-free, buffered, and passed the Photographic Activity Test (PAT) to ensure the highest level of protection for your documents. Investing in top-notch archival boxes may cost a bit more upfront, but the long-term benefits of safeguarding your important papers far outweigh the initial expense.

    In addition to storing documents in archival boxes, it’s essential to handle them with care and follow proper handling and storage guidelines. Avoid touching the papers with bare hands, as oils and dirt from your skin can cause damage. Use clean, dry hands or wear cotton gloves when handling documents to minimize the risk of contamination. Store archival boxes in a cool, dry, and dark environment away from direct sunlight, heat sources, or moisture to maintain optimal conditions for preservation.

    Furthermore, periodically check your documents for signs of deterioration, such as discoloration, brittleness, mold, or pest infestations. If you notice any of these issues, take immediate steps to address them, such as consulting a professional conservator or archivist for guidance on proper care and conservation techniques.

  • Buying Guide For A Used John Deere: What You Need To Know

    When it comes to purchasing farm equipment, John Deere is a household name that many farmers trust. Known for its quality and durability, John Deere tractors are a popular choice among agricultural enthusiasts. However, buying a brand new John Deere tractor can be quite expensive, which is why many people opt to purchase a used John Deere instead. In this article, we will discuss everything you need to know about buying a used John Deere tractor.

    Why Buy a used john deere?

    There are several reasons why buying a used John Deere tractor may be a better option than purchasing a brand new one. Firstly, used John Deere tractors are significantly cheaper than new ones, allowing buyers to save a substantial amount of money. Additionally, used tractors have already gone through their initial depreciation, meaning that they retain their value better over time compared to new tractors.

    Moreover, buying a used John Deere tractor allows buyers to access older models that may be no longer in production. These older models often have simpler designs and are easier to repair, making them a popular choice among farmers who prefer DIY maintenance. Finally, since John Deere tractors are known for their reliability and longevity, purchasing a used one can be a cost-effective investment that will serve you well for many years to come.

    Factors to Consider When Buying a used john deere

    When shopping for a used John Deere tractor, there are several factors that you need to take into consideration to ensure that you are making a wise investment. One of the most important factors to consider is the tractor’s age and hours of use. While older models may be cheaper, they may also come with more wear and tear, leading to potential repair issues in the future. On the other hand, newer models with fewer hours of use may come with a higher price tag but are likely to be in better condition.

    It is also crucial to inspect the tractor’s maintenance history. A well-maintained tractor will perform better and have fewer issues down the line. Ask the seller for detailed records of all maintenance and repairs that have been done on the tractor, including oil changes, filter replacements, and any major repairs. If the seller cannot provide these records, it may be a red flag indicating that the tractor has not been properly cared for.

    In addition, you should physically inspect the tractor for any signs of damage or wear. Look for rust, leaks, dents, and other visible damage that may indicate that the tractor has been poorly maintained or involved in accidents. Take the tractor for a test drive to assess its performance and listen for any unusual noises that may signal underlying mechanical issues.

    Where to Buy a used john deere

    There are several places where you can purchase a used John Deere tractor. One option is to buy directly from a John Deere dealership, where you can be assured of the tractor’s authenticity and quality. Dealerships often have a wide selection of used tractors to choose from and may offer financing options to help you afford your purchase.

    Another option is to buy from a private seller or through online marketplaces such as eBay or Craigslist. While buying from a private seller may be cheaper, it is essential to thoroughly inspect the tractor and ask for maintenance records to ensure that you are getting a good deal. Be cautious of deals that seem too good to be true, as they may indicate that the tractor has hidden issues that will be costly to repair.

  • Effective Literacy Strategies For Reading

    Literacy is a fundamental skill that is essential for success in all areas of life. From reading books, newspapers, and emails to understanding instructions, literacy plays a crucial role in daily activities. When it comes to reading, there are various strategies that can help individuals improve their reading skills and comprehension. In this article, we will explore some effective literacy strategies for reading.

    1. Pre-Reading Activities

    Before diving into a text, it can be helpful to engage in pre-reading activities. This can include scanning the text for headings, subheadings, and keywords to get an overview of the content. Additionally, previewing any visuals, such as images, graphs, or charts, can provide context and help with comprehension. By activating prior knowledge and making predictions based on the pre-reading activities, readers can better understand the text.

    2. Active Reading

    Active reading is a strategy that involves engaging with the text while reading. This can include highlighting key points, taking notes, asking questions, and making connections to prior knowledge. By actively interacting with the text, readers can improve their understanding and retention of information. Active reading also helps readers stay focused and avoid distractions, leading to a more effective reading experience.

    3. Chunking

    Chunking is a technique that involves breaking down the text into smaller chunks or sections. By focusing on one chunk at a time, readers can better process and comprehend the information. This strategy is especially helpful for complex or lengthy texts. Readers can pause after each chunk to reflect on the information and check their understanding before moving on to the next section.

    4. Visualization

    Visualizing the content of the text can aid in comprehension and retention. Readers can create mental images of the characters, settings, and events described in the text. This can help bring the text to life and make it more engaging. Visualizing also allows readers to make connections between the text and their own experiences, enhancing their understanding of the material.

    5. Summarizing

    After reading a text, it can be beneficial to summarize the main ideas and key points. Summarizing helps readers consolidate their understanding of the material and identify the most important information. Readers can create summaries in their own words, in the form of bullet points or a mind map. This strategy can also be used to review the text later and refresh one’s memory of the content.

    6. Making Inferences

    Making inferences involves reading between the lines and drawing conclusions based on the information presented in the text. This critical thinking skill helps readers go beyond the literal meaning of the text and understand the underlying messages or themes. By making inferences, readers can deepen their comprehension and engage more deeply with the text.

    7. Monitoring Comprehension

    It is essential for readers to monitor their comprehension while reading. This involves being aware of whether or not they are understanding the text. Readers can ask themselves questions such as, “Does this make sense?” or “Do I understand what the author is trying to convey?” If comprehension is lacking, readers can use strategies such as re-reading, seeking clarification, or looking up unfamiliar words to improve understanding.

    8. Practice and Persistence

    Improving reading skills takes practice and persistence. Readers should make reading a regular habit and challenge themselves with a variety of texts. By reading regularly, individuals can strengthen their vocabulary, comprehension, and critical thinking skills. Additionally, persistence is key to overcoming any obstacles or difficulties that may arise while reading.
